Common Roofing Concerns That Demand Professional Assistance
Roofing installations can face a range of common issues that necessitate professional intervention. One frequent issue is roof leaks, which can arise from damaged shingles, flashing, or worn seals. Moreover, faulty installation or wear and tear can cause sagging roofs, compromising structural integrity. Another common problem involves clogged gutters, which can create water buildup and subsequent damage to the roofing materials. Moreover, homeowners may experience issues with moss and algae growth, which can damage shingles and lead to further complications. Finally, inadequate ventilation can lead to excessive heat and moisture accumulation, creating an environment for mold growth. Recognizing these issues early and seeking professional help can stop more extensive damage and costly repairs in the long run.

Age Of The Roof
Even though a carefully maintained roof can last for many years, age stands as a critical factor in deciding whether a replacement is needed. Generally, asphalt shingles can last between 20 and 30 years, while metal roofs can endure up to 50 years or beyond. As roofs deteriorate over time, their ability to withstand environmental stresses declines, resulting in potential issues. Homeowners should consider a roof replacement when it comes close to the end of its projected lifespan, even if visible damage is not obvious. This proactive approach serves to prevent more severe difficulties down the line. Additionally, local climate conditions, including heavy snowfall or intense heat, can considerably influence a roof's longevity, making regular evaluations essential for sound decision-making related to replacements.
Signs Of Damage
Property owners must stay alert for signs of damage that may indicate the need for a roof replacement. Frequent signals include missing or cracked shingles, which leave vulnerable the underlying structure to moisture. In addition, bent or warping shingles indicate deterioration, while granules building up in gutters may indicate considerable wear. Evidence of water stains or mold on ceilings and walls reveal potential leaks, necessitating immediate attention. A sagging roofline can additionally point to framework concerns requiring urgent evaluation. Moreover, if the roof is approaching or has exceeded its expected lifespan, proactive measures should be considered. By recognizing these signs early, homeowners can make educated decisions about their roofing needs, potentially averting costly repairs down the line.

Considerations for Material Durability
Even though property owners typically prioritize appearance and expense, the longevity of roofing materials is a critical factor that should not be overlooked. Selecting the right material can substantially affect a roof's durability and performance. Common options include asphalt shingles, metal, tile, and slate, each providing varying levels of resilience against weather elements. Asphalt shingles, while cost-effective, generally last 15-30 years, whereas metal roofs can last up to 50 years or more. Clay and concrete tiles deliver remarkable durability and resistance to fire, but their weight requires proper structural support. Homeowners should evaluate local climate conditions and potential wear factors when making their selection, as these elements will ultimately influence both maintenance demands and replacement frequency over time.

What to Look for in a Roofing Contractor?
When searching for a trustworthy roofing contractor, what key qualities should a homeowner prioritize? First, a contractor's license and insurance are critical, as they reflect professionalism and protect homeowners from liability. Experience in the roofing industry is likewise essential; well-established contractors often have a demonstrated history of quality work. Homeowners should seek out references and reviews to determine customer satisfaction and reliability. Additionally, a good contractor will provide comprehensive written estimates, guaranteeing transparency in pricing and scope of work. Communication skills are equally important, as clear communication fosters trust and smooth project execution. To conclude, a robust warranty on workmanship and materials shows confidence in the services offered, giving homeowners security with respect to their investment.

What Actions Should I Take if Storm Damage Occurs to My Roof?
If a roof is damaged during a storm, the homeowner should inspect the damage, document it with photos, call their insurance provider, and retain a qualified roofing professional for repairs to ensure safety and proper restoration.
